Ipr Strips Orthodontics. Ipr involves removing small amounts of outer enamel tooth surface between two adjacent teeth. Ipr is a safe and effective method to create space for orthodontic tooth movement where mild or moderate crowding exists, particularly useful for treating crowding in the.
